Be careful when replacing CPX valve
terminals with saved
parameterisation.
With these CPX valve terminals,
parameterisation is not carried out
automatically by the higher-order
PLC/IPC when the terminal is
replaced. In these cases, check which
settings are required before the
replacement and make these settings
if necessary.
